Stanwood El School Enrollment By Gender
The student body of Stanwood El School in New Stanton, Westmoreland County, Pennsylvania is about evenly split between males and females. The male population of the school is slightly larger; 319 of the 630 students (50.6 %) are male whereas 311 of the 630 students (49.4 %) are female.
Gender | Number | % |
---|---|---|
Female | 311 | 49.4 % |
Male | 319 | 50.6 % |
Stanwood El School Enrollment By Race
The student body of Stanwood El School in New Stanton, Westmoreland County, Pennsylvania is made up of 6 ethnicities. The largest ethnic group of the 630 students at Stanwood El School is White. This is followed by Black (3.8 %), Asian (1.0 %), Hispanic (1.0 %), Indian (0.8 %) and Mixed Students of two or more ethnicities (0.2 %).
Race | Number | % |
---|---|---|
Indian | 5 | 0.8 % |
Asian | 6 | 1.0 % |
Hispanic | 6 | 1.0 % |
Black | 24 | 3.8 % |
White | 588 | 93.3 % |
Two or More Ethnicities | 1 | 0.2 % |
